Brokers' claims deluge fears are allayed by FOS chief

Tony Boorman, principal Ombudsman, moved to qualm brokers' fears that they will be inundated with costly and vexatious claims under the Financial Ombudsman Service (FOS) scheme and end up being forced to settle claims from ambulance chasers they would normally defend.
